Definition
Gardener; a person who cares for plants in a garden.
neutralpeoplenature
How it's used
Refers specifically to someone who maintains gardens or parks as a profession. While it is the standard term, in casual daily life, people often use more descriptive phrases like 負責打理花園嘅人 to avoid sounding overly formal or literary.
